netfs: Adjust the netfs_failure tracepoint to indicate non-subreq lines
Adjust the netfs_failure tracepoint to indicate a subrequest number of -1
when it's a full-request failure unrelated to any particular subrequest,
such as a failure to encrypt its data buffer.
